Continuum Mechanical Modeling of Solids Undergoing a Phase Transformation.

Abstract

This report summarizes our research on the continuum mechanical modeling of materials that undergo stress and temperature induced phase transitions. It contains a problem statement, a summary of results, a list of publications, and names of personnel. The results pertain to the construction of the model, the study of the model in both quasi-static and inertial settings, a study of coupled thermomechanical effects, a study of cyclic effects and comparison with experiments.
